   > I've always been interested in an entry level older BMW.   
      
   I once owned a 525i on which I had to replace almost everything because BMW   
   only knows how to make drive trains - BMW has no idea how systems work   
   together.   
      
   An example is the DISA valve is an abomination, as is the CCV and even the   
   ABS control module has those angel hairs which break in the goop they're   
   intertwined with.   
      
   The seat cables cause seat twist. Even something as simple as the   
   cupholders break. The Dorman window regulators have too small of a nylon   
   roller so the cable falls off. And don't even get me started on the Behr   
   plastic overly complex expansion tanks.   
      
   The water pump fails prematurely (and requires two special tools, including   
   a very thin very long 32mm open-end wrench to access), while the trunk loom   
   constantly frays causing shorts all over the place due to bare wires   
   touching.   
      
   Everyone had the BMW software (much of which was in German) including but   
   not limited to dis, easydis, gt1, progman, inpa, and ncs dummies & expert.
